Output 338262d277aa0153cc0c6ad5d92e650c9b670c0d11ba15b5343d340fd5809b51:26

value
41360000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70bc0e3ae31d7b55c24984a73172b1ddaf812425 OP_EQUAL
address
3By6tMq7jkkYRKU6dm9jMy2NjnSkjpkDJH
transaction
338262d277aa0153cc0c6ad5d92e650c9b670c0d11ba15b5343d340fd5809b51
spent
true